Tailoring Therapy Plans: A Personalized Approach to Autism Care
Autism is a spectrum that presents in a wide variety of ways. Therefore, there's no one-size-fits-all approach to care. That's why personalizing therapy plans is crucial for delivering effective support.
A personalized therapy plan takes into reflection the individual needs, strengths, and challenges of each person having autism. This involves a detailed assessment to identify their unique traits.
Therapists then collaborate with families and the individual to create a plan that addresses their specific aspirations. This may encompass a range of therapies, such as speech therapy, occupational therapy, or behavioral therapy.
By tailoring therapy plans, we can maximize the outcomes of treatment and empower individuals with autism to prosper in all areas of their lives.
